Confirmed: Windows Phone 7 launches October 11th in New York City, and T-Mobile's on board

If there was any scrap of doubt in your mind, we'll obliterate it for you right now -- October 11th is the day Windows Phone 7 will be unveiled in the US, not just at a fancy London event... and wonder of wonders, T-Mobile's the star of the show. Looks like AT&T won't be launching Metro UI handsets all alone, eh? The event agenda clearly states there will be "an exclusive showing of T-Mobile powered Windows Phone 7 devices" at 3:30PM EST, and you can bet your britches we'll be there live to cover the whole thing.

[Thanks, James T.]